Rich,
That 22 foot Penske drives like a dream, the truck
moves right along and gets good gas mileage.
Just remember that you have to stop at those
areas that have the lights on for weight stations.

Some times the other cars can follow you in and wait
1 or 2 of those stations have no room for the others to stay behind you, so keep that in mind. we stayed overnight in Virginia
as well on way down from NY, just pad lock the rear door and put it away for the night
